Summary: Unedited scenes showing naval "saboteurs" in Malta.
Description: I. Miscellaneous underwater shots of "saboteurs" (without mines): one swims up to the surface to look about, using a floating orange crate as cover; divers rendezvous by a mooring cable and, having orientated themselves, swim off; saboteur swims away from a ship.
II. Surface scenes: saboteurs surface around a buoy - they reconnoitre and then submerge; diver porpoises in a MSC (motor submersible canoe); saboteur swims just below the surface; a group of three divers on the surface - they submerge.
III. Underwater sequence as diver attaches a clamp mine to the blade of a ship's propeller; RN diver works loose a torpedo-like clamp mine which has been attached to ship's bilge keel - he tugs on an attached line, and the mine is hauled up to the surface. Similar sequence shows a diver searching the bottom of the ship to discover a cylindrical clamp mine on the bilge keel - he obtains a line from a fleet clearance launch secured alongside the ship, and attaches it to the mine before attempting to pull it free from the keel.
